(Tallahassee, FL) -- Florida State University will try to return to normal today. Classes will resume, but the school is also offering students a choice of going remote. The school says it wants everyone to receive the support and help they need, and that means different things for different students. Meanwhile, flags across the state will remain at half-staff today. Governor Ron DeSantis said Friday flags would fly at half-staff for the victims and to recognize the bravery shown by first responders. Flags will remain at half staff until sunset.
